How Can I Learn More About God (Part 1)
Think
for a moment about the characteristics of God
that impress you most from what He has revealed
about Himself in nature, Scripture and Jesus
Christ. Nature reveals God's Glory;
Scripture reveals His Sovereignty and love for
the world (John 3:16); Jesus Christ reveals
salvation and peace. God really has made
Himself known in some mighty ways.
Even though you may understand quite a bit about
God through nature, the Scriptures, and Jesus
Christ, there still may be some things about him
that you find to be confusing-like why He allows
evil, suffering, and death; what heaven will be
like; and how and when Christ will return to
earth. Some things about God remain a
mystery. As a matter of fact Deuteronomy
29:29 says: The secret things belong to
the Lord our God, but the things revealed belong
to us and to our children forever, that we may
follow all the words of this law. Don't expect
that by studying the Scriptures and reflecting
on creation you will learn every possible thing
about God. But you can be sure that
whatever God has revealed is exactly what you
need to know how to be saved and how to live a
life that's pleasing to Him.
There are plenty of benefits to be gained from
learning and following God's Word. Psalm 119
lists a few. Verse 11 says that if you know
God's Word it will help guard you from
sin. Verse 18 says that when you ask God
he will show you wonderful things in His
law. In verse 24, God's statutes are
said to be a person's counselors. They can help
you find solutions to your problems. Verses 50
and 52 say that you can receive comfort from
God's word when you suffer. Note verses 98
and 99. God's Word can make you wiser than
your enemies and can give you insight beyond
your years. Verse 104 says that you can
gain insight from the precepts in God's Word.
And verse 105 says that God's word lights your
way and keeps you from stumbling. Finally,
note what verse 165 says. It is God's Word that
gives you peace of mind. To learn more about God
and to experience these benefits in Your life,
you must spend time in His word.
Becoming familiar with God's Word brings another
important benefit to you. Your faith will
increase. Paul notes in Romans 10:17 that faith
comes from hearing the message, and the message
is heard through the word of Christ. The more
you study God's Word, the more you learn about
God. The more you learn about God, the more your
faith grows. The more your faith grows, the more
you see god revealed to you. Your eyes will be
opened to God and all blessings that He
offers. Now that is a benefit worth
having.
